The signature of documents involved in a divorce process may be signed separately by spouses, no matter if they reside in different cities, states or even countries. The same document will just be signed by wife in front of a Notary Public and then this document will be legalized by the Foreign Relations Ministry (The Department of State in the United States and so on) with the Apostille legalization (or by Consulate of Dominican Republic where no Apostille is possible) and finally sent to us in Santo Domingo for filing divorce petition.
